linux安装MongoDB

1. 安装 EPEL
注意,如果曾经没有安装过epel,会导致安装无法进行,
安装epel
rpm -Uvh http://mirrors.ustc.edu.cn/fedora/epel/6/x86_64/epel-release-6-8.noarch.rpm

2.安装MongoDB

yum install mongodb mongodb-server  mongodb-devel

如果要用于php,再继续安装php扩展
yum install php-pecl-mongo

3.配置/etc/mongodb.conf

    port = 27017 #端口号
    fork = true
    logpath = /var/log/mongodb/mongodb.log #日志路径

    pidfilepath = /var/run/mongodb/mongodb.pid 可指定进程文件存放位置

    dbpath =/var/lib/mongodb #数据库路径
    journal = true
    auth = true #把auth打开,表示可以验证用户名密码   

3 启动

service mongod start        #启动
主要看终端显示是否ok

netstat -tpnl|grep 27017     #查看
//使用这个命令查看,是为了看27017端口是否被mongo占用了,以确定它成功运行

4,添加管理员账户
mongo    #连接
use admin

//添加用户
db.addUser('root','123456')

mongo3.6:

db.createUser({user:"root",pwd:"pass",roles:["dbAdmin"]})

//登录

db.auth("root", "123456")

猜你喜欢

转载自my.oschina.net/u/3830635/blog/1800130